用vba可以模拟按下键盘按键的效果。
在excel中可以使用Application对象的SendKeys方法或者直接使用VBA中的SendKeys语句模拟按下键盘中的按键的效果。
SendKeys[……]
阅读全文>>>关注和分享Excel以及Office系列软件的方方面面,致力于提高中国的办公软件的使用水平
MD5 可以作为文件的指纹。
MD5就可以为任何文件(不管其大小、格式、数量)产生一个同样独一无二的“数字指纹”,如果任何人对文件做了任何改动,其MD5值也就是对应的“数字指纹”都会发生变化。
如[……]
阅读全文>>>比如将字符串 “abcdef”转变成”fedcba”。
在vba中内置了StrReverse函数可以直接将字符串的字符颠倒逆序输出,也就是从右到左输出原字符串的字符。
代码如下:
Sub QQ1[......]阅读全文>>>
如下图所示
在工作簿1中选中了4个工作表。
如果要用vba判断选中的是哪些工作表,可以使用Window对象的SelectedSheets属性。
代码如下:
Sub QQ172218[......]阅读全文>>>
对于vba代码很多的时候,如果要批量删除vba代码中的代码注释,或者代码空行,可以使用如下的通用代码:
以下代码将批量删除工作表1中的所有vba代码中的注释和空行。
Sub QQ1722187970([......]阅读全文>>>
在excel中可以使用“数据”选项卡下的“获取外部数据”组中的“自文本”功能导入文本文档的数据,如下图所示
在excel vba中内置了QueryTable对象可以实现上述导入外部文本文档的数据[……]
阅读全文>>>用用vba清空删除工作表中的所有数据透视表会涉及到几个容易混淆的概念。
第一个是清空数据透视表的所有内容,但是保留数据透视表刚创建时的样子,也就是没有字段拖动到透视表区域,这时候可以使用PivotTab[……]
阅读全文>>>如下图所示
在excel的“开发工具”选项卡下的“控件”组中可以插入表单控件和ActiveX控件。
表单控件又称为窗体控件,不能响应事件。
ActiveX控件可以响应事件。
在[……]
阅读全文>>>如下图所示
在excel中可以使用合并计算功能将多个单元格区域进行汇总计算,在进行合并计算时,首先添加要合并计算的单元格区域,然后选择汇总方式,可以设置标签位置是在首行、还是最左列。
如果[……]
阅读全文>>>